为了解决Python模块错误以启用Web抓取脚本,您可以按照以下步骤进行操作:
- 确认Python环境:首先,确保您已正确安装Python并且可以在终端或命令提示符中运行Python解释器。可以通过输入
python --version
命令来验证Python的安装和版本。 - 安装缺失的模块:如果出现模块错误,很可能是缺少相关模块。您可以使用Python的包管理工具pip来安装所需的模块。例如,如果缺少requests模块,可以运行
pip install requests
命令来安装。 - 版本兼容性:如果您的脚本使用的是较新版本的Python,而某些模块只支持旧版本的Python,则可能会出现兼容性问题。在这种情况下,您可以尝试升级模块或降级Python版本以解决兼容性问题。
- 导入模块:在Python脚本中,确保您在使用该模块之前正确导入了相应的模块。例如,如果要使用requests模块,您需要在脚本的顶部添加
import requests
语句。 - 检查代码错误:检查您的代码,确保没有语法错误或逻辑错误。模块错误有时可能是由于代码错误引起的。
- 查找模块文档:如果您对特定模块的使用方式不熟悉,可以查找该模块的文档或官方文档以获取更多信息。通常,模块的官方文档会提供示例代码和详细的说明,帮助您正确地使用该模块。
关于Web抓取脚本,它是指通过编写Python脚本来自动获取互联网上的数据。Web抓取脚本通常使用HTTP请求库(如requests)来发送HTTP请求,并使用解析库(如Beautiful Soup)来解析HTML或XML数据。通过使用Web抓取脚本,您可以自动化获取网页内容、爬取数据、进行数据分析等。
以下是一些相关的腾讯云产品和产品介绍链接地址,供您参考:
- 腾讯云CVM(云服务器):提供高性能、可弹性伸缩的云服务器实例,支持多种操作系统和应用场景。了解更多:CVM产品介绍
- 腾讯云COS(对象存储):提供高可靠、低成本的云存储服务,适用于各种数据存储和应用场景。了解更多:COS产品介绍
- 腾讯云SCF(云函数):无服务器的事件驱动函数计算服务,可用于执行独立的代码逻辑。了解更多:SCF产品介绍
请注意,以上链接仅供参考,您可以根据自己的需求进一步了解和选择适合的腾讯云产品。